How many vehicles have been affected by campaign V04.
Approximately 392,850 vehicles are involved. All 1999 – 2002 MY 2.0L Elantras and 1999 – 2003 MY 2.0L Tiburons produced through January 31, 2002.

What is campaign V04 about?
Hyundai has determined that the exhaust manifold in your 1999-2002 MY 2.0L Elantra or 1999-2003 MY 2.0L Tiburon produced through January 31, 2002, may be subject to cracking.

Have there been any accidents or injuries as a result of this condition in Campaign V04?
Although this condition may affect vehicle exhaust emissions, it does not result in accidents or injuries

What does the repair for V04 entail?
To ensure that your vehicle’s exhaust manifold is not cracked, we will inspect your vehicle on your next visit to a Hyundai dealer. If the exhaust manifold is cracked, we will replace it at no cost to you.

Is there any charge for the repair of V04?
No, the repair is performed at no charge to the customer. In addition, if the manifold is not cracked, Hyundai will extend the warranty on this part to 10 years and unlimited mileage.

I've already paid for replacing the exhaust manifold. Will Hyundai reimburse for the repair?
If you have previously replaced the exhaust manifold due to a crack, you may be entitled to a reimbursement for this cost. The original service repair receipts with the vehicle’s 17 digit VIN, and the date and mileage at the time of repair will be required for review of your request for reimbursement. Was this recall initiated by NHTSA?
No, this is not a recall and the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ration (NHTSA) is not involved in emission related matters. This is a voluntary service campaign initiated by Hyundai, but it is being conducted in agreement with the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) and California Air Resources Board

How many vehicles have been affected by campaign 066.
Certain 2002 and 2003 model year Elantra, Sonata, Tiburon, and XG 350 vehicles, produced during the period of October 1, 2001 through November 9, 2002, may fail to conform to the requirements of Federal Motor Vehicle Safety Standard 301, Fuel System Integrity. Approximately 264,000 vehicles are affected.

Why are these vehicles being recalled?
A valve on the fuel tank assembly may not close properly . If a vehicle rolls over and the fuel tank assembly is not properly closed, a small amount of fuel spillage may occur.

What does the repair entail for campaign 066?
The repair involves the installation of an additional fuel tank assembly valve. We urge you to call your Hyundai dealer to schedule an appointment to have this work performed as soon as possible. Repair times will vary and depend on your dealer’s appointment schedule.

Was campaign 066 initiated by NHTSA?
This is a voluntary recall initiated by Hyundai, but it is being conducted in full accordance with NHTSA recall procedure requirements.
